Trump is expected to discuss TikTok's fate in the Oval Office on Wednesday

image

The White House says President Donald Trump is expected to hold a meeting on Wednesday (April 2) to discuss a potential buyer for short video platform TikTok.

Reuters reported that a senior White House official said the meeting will be held in the Oval Office and will include senior Cabinet members, Vice President Vance and White House National Security Adviser Michael Walz.

The US Senate passed a bill in April 2024, which limited TikTok's Chinese parent company ByteDance to sell TikTok's US business to non-Chinese companies before January 19, 2025, on the grounds of national security, or it will be completely banned in the United States. After taking office this year, Trump signed an executive order that pushed back the deadline to divest TikTok to April 5.

TikTok has 170 million users in the United States.
